**Assessing COPD-Specific Care: Key Metrics**

Beyond general hospital ratings, several specific metrics are crucial for evaluating COPD care:

* **Readmission Rates:** Low readmission rates for COPD patients indicate effective management and patient education.
* **Bronchodilator Administration Times:** Timely administration of bronchodilators during exacerbations is critical for patient outcomes.
* **Pulmonary Rehabilitation Programs:** Access to comprehensive pulmonary rehabilitation programs, including exercise training, education, and psychosocial support, is essential for improving quality of life.
* **Smoking Cessation Programs:** Effective smoking cessation programs are vital for preventing disease progression and improving patient outcomes.
* **Access to Respiratory Therapists:** The availability of experienced respiratory therapists is crucial for providing respiratory support and education.

**Evaluating Telehealth and Remote Monitoring Programs**

Telehealth and remote monitoring programs can significantly improve COPD management. When evaluating these programs, consider:

* **Availability of Virtual Consultations:** Access to pulmonologists and respiratory therapists via video or phone calls.
* **Remote Monitoring Devices:** Use of devices like pulse oximeters and spirometers to monitor patient’s condition at home.
* **Patient Education and Support:** Resources for patient education and support, including self-management strategies.
* **Data Security and Privacy:** Compliance with HIPAA regulations and data security protocols.
